TypeScript cannot handle type information for .vue
imports by default, so we replace the tsc
CLI with vue-tsc
for type checking. In editors, we need TypeScript Vue Plugin (Volar) to make the TypeScript language service aware of .vue
types.

You'll need NPM, node.js, and Python 3.10 or later.
- Clone this repository locally and enter the directory:
git clone https://github.com/addison-codes/calculator.git && cd calculator
- Install packages:
npm i
- Navigate to server directory:
cd server
- Create virtual env:
python -m venv env
- Run the virtual env:
source env/bin/activate
- Navigate back to server directory and have Python virtualenv install python requirements:
pip install -r requirements.txt
- Run Flask server:
python app.py
Finally, in another terminal window at the main project directory, run npm run dev
and follow the prompts to open it locally.
